Are people in Danville older or younger than people in Scappoose?
- The Median Age in Danville is 2.7 years younger than in Scappoose.

Are housing costs cheaper in Danville or Scappoose?
- Danville housing costs are 52.9% less expensive than Scappoose hous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Danville or Scappoose?
- The average commute for residents of Danville is 14.2 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Scappoose.

Things to do in Scappoose?
Scappoose, OR is a beautiful small town located in Columbia County. It has a population of roughly 6,000 people and is situated along the banks of the Columbia River. This picturesque area offers many outdoor activities such as camping, hiking, fishing and boating. The local economy is largely based on agriculture and forestry with a variety of farms, markets and businesses operating in the area. Additionally, Scappoose has excellent schools and offers plenty of opportunities for leisure activities, such as shopping and dining at local restaurants. No matter what you're looking for in life, living in Scappoose, OR can be an incredibly rewarding experience.

Things to do in Danville?
Danville, Kentucky is the county seat of Boyle County located 30 miles south-east of Lexington. The downtown area features unique boutiques and restaurants that allow visitors to explore the past while enjoying delicious food and locally made gifts!
